Snatcher Caught Red-Handed in Dwarka; Police Nab Accused Within 100 Metres After Bus Theft

New Delhi: In a swift action, Delhi Police apprehended a snatching accused red-handed in Dwarka during a morning picket operation on Ramapark Road.

The team led by Sub-Inspector Rajat Malik acted promptly after a man stole a mobile phone from a woman inside a bus and attempted to flee. Upon hearing the victim raise an alarm, police chased the accused and managed to nab him within 100 metres of the spot.

The accused has been identified as Yogendra Sharma (38), a resident of Mohan Garden. Police recovered the stolen mobile phone and arrested him on the spot.

Officials confirmed that the accused was produced before the court, which denied him bail the same day. The incident highlights the alertness and quick response of the police in preventing street crimes in the area.
